Dog Bite Attorney Florida

In Florida, dog owners are held strictly liable for injuries caused by their dogs, even if the dog has never shown signs of aggression before. This means that if you are bitten by a dog in Florida, the owner can be held responsible for your injuries, regardless of the dog’s previous behavior. Common Injuries from Dog Bites

Dog bites can result in a wide range of injuries, some of which may require extensive medical treatment and long-term care. Common injuries from dog bites include:

  • Puncture Wounds: Deep puncture wounds from a dog’s teeth can lead to significant bleeding, nerve damage, and infections.
  • Lacerations and Scarring: Dog bites often cause severe cuts and tears in the skin, leading to scarring and disfigurement. In some cases, reconstructive surgery may be necessary.
  • Infections: Dog bites carry a high risk of infection due to the bacteria present in a dog’s mouth. Infections such as rabies, tetanus, and sepsis can occur if the wound is not properly treated.
  • Broken Bones: In severe attacks, a dog’s bite can break bones, particularly in the hands, arms, and face.
  • Emotional Trauma: The psychological impact of a dog bite can be profound, leading to anxiety, post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D), and a lifelong fear of dogs.

Proving Liability in Dog Bite Cases

Proving liability in a dog bite case often involves demonstrating that the dog’s owner was responsible for the attack. The legal strategy we use will depend on the laws in your state and the specific circumstances of the attack. At Ironclad Injury Law, we take the following steps to build a strong case for our clients:

1. Gathering Evidence

We begin by collecting all relevant evidence, including medical records, photographs of injuries, witness statements, and any available video footage of the incident. This evidence is crucial in establishing the severity of the injuries and the circumstances surrounding the attack.

2. Consulting Medical Experts

Medical experts play a vital role in dog bite cases, particularly when it comes to proving the extent of your injuries and the long-term impact on your health. We work with top medical professionals who can provide expert testimony to support your claim.

3. Establishing the Owner’s Liability

Depending on the state, we may need to prove that the dog owner was negligent in controlling their dog or that the dog had a history of aggression. In states with strict liability laws, we’ll focus on proving that the attack occurred and that the owner is responsible for the resulting damages.
